User stephencolbert banned on Wikipedia
Stephen Colbert during his program The Colbert Report introduced the term ‘wikiality’ - the reality that exists if you make something up and enough people agree with you - it becomes reality. Stephen Colbert also modified the page on George Washington saying that he had the right to believe that Washington had no slaves. He also urged his audience to find the page on Elephants in Wikipedia and create an entry which stated that the population of elephants has nearly tripled in the past ten years (a fact that’s untrue). One of the Wikipedia administrators who actually watched the program immediately reverted the pages to their original state and banned the user stephencolbert from Wikipedia. The page on elephants is now protected and further editing cannot be done unless a request is made.
